Russ Moore Transmission Specialist (West) / Arcola, Indiana
Rating: ☆
Auto Repair & Service, Automobile Parts & Supplies, Auto Transmission
Address: 1019B Avenue Of Autos, Arcola
Postal code: 46804
Phone: (260) 255-4984
Call today for an appointment
Green Works Energy specializes in Solar PV, Small Wind, and Solar Thermal - Works with customers through entire process from design, installation, monitoring and maintenance - Customized system for each customer - Free Site Evaluations. Battery Retail & Wholesale Center - Free Battery & System Check - Locally Owned & Operated - Member of BBB and over 45 Years Experience Authorized Service Center